Abstract
A method of forming a multi-component structure, the method including: co-extruding at least one polymer and a shear- thickening fluid to form a multi-component structure; wherein an interior region of the multi-component structure includes the shear-thickening fluid; and wherein an outer region of the multi-component structure includes the at least one polymer. Also disclosed is a multi-component structure including: at least one polymer; and a shear-thickening fluid; wherein an interior region of the multi-component structure comprises the shear-thickening fluid; and wherein an outer region of the multi-component structure comprises the at least one polymer.
